What early algae looks as if whenever you realize wherein to look

Most homeowners in basic terms notice algae whilst the roof seems blotchy from the street. By then, it has always been spreading for a few seasons. In its early degree, algae suggests up as faint, smoky shadows that observe downward following water run-off paths. Imagine a watercolor wash that begins close a roof vent or ridge and trails into thinner strains a few toes beneath. You received’t routinely see a bright efficient patch. The residing cells form a dark defensive sheath while exposed to UV, so the shade skews charcoal or brownish-black.

Early streaks normally be aware of the north and northeast slopes first. Those planes get less direct solar, so that they dry out later in the day. If your roof is partly shaded by using a sugar maple, oak, or a tall gable, the section simply under that shadow line is wherein easy streaking starts. Another trace is round penetrations: the shingles downhill from a chimney, skylight, or satellite mount will most likely instruct the primary marks, as a result of hardware interrupts water circulate and creates tiny moisture pockets.

If you climb a ladder for a closer seem to be, you’ll see fantastic, peppery speckling that wipes to a faint smear on a white cloth. Do now not scrub, and do now not pull on granules. The function is to have a look at, no longer refreshing from a ladder. A shut inspection enables you to rule out other growths and determine out if that's a case for Roof Cleaning or some thing with greater implications.

Algae, mildew, lichen, moss: telling the players apart

Misidentification leads to negative cleansing possible choices. Algae responds to smooth wash chemistry and mild method. Moss and lichen are diverse beasts that take longer to clean and might call for a couple of options.

  • Algae on shingles seems like charcoal streaks, skinny and diffuse. It does not have top possible pinch between two palms.
  • Lichen items as flat, coin-sized crusts in faded green or gray that bite into the granules. They appear to be mini continents with tough edges. Lichen clings exhausting, so ripping at it tears granules off, which you need to ward off.
  • Moss grows in which moisture lingers all day, resembling underneath overhanging branches or alongside valleys. It has a spongy, tufted sense and stands proud of the shingle floor. Moss can raise shingles with the aid of its root construction and grasp water in opposition to the mat.
  • Mold and mildew are extra fashionable in soffits and siding. On roofs, what many call “mold” is veritably the related UV-secure algae movie.

A seasoned Roof Cleaning pro can spot the change from the ground quality professional roof cleaning solutions with binoculars, then make certain from the eaves in the time of a safety-aware stroll-around. For home owners, the key's to word peak, texture, and sample. Thin and streaky points to algae. Raised and patchy aspects to moss or lichen.

What the ones streaks are doing in your roof

There is a known delusion that algae is just beauty. Up close, algae does greater than make the shingles seem to be worn-out. It consumes the limestone filler in asphalt composites, and at the same time as it does so slowly, the system can loosen the bond that retains granules embedded. Those granules offer protection to the asphalt from UV. As algae spreads and as granules shed, UV hits the asphalt base harder, which accelerates drying and brittleness. Over a number of seasons, shingles can curl and lose flexibility. That sets the stage for wind uplift and unsealed tabs.

Algae also allows hold nice mud and spores in position. Once you've a mature algae film, moss spores find a secure abode in the dampest pockets. Moss then traps even greater moisture, that can creep under shingle edges and along nail lines. Valleys and the lowest 1/3 of lengthy runs see the worst of it. You will now not be aware a leak from algae alone, but when a storm drives rain sideways, weakened, curled shingles fail quicker.

On metal roofs, the story ameliorations. Algae does no longer consume steel, but it will probably stain and compile particles opposed to fasteners and less than seams. That pile-up holds water and will inspire floor oxidation in scratches and micro-abrasions. Metal is greater forgiving, but it nonetheless reward from periodic Roof Washing, pretty in shaded hollows and below standing seams in which leaves sit after a storm.

Cedar shakes and different wooden products are a distinct concern. Algae ends up in blotchy coloration and might pave the way for fungal staining. With wood, you favor a softer, shrink-chemical process that respects the lignin and avoids stripping average oils. Why force is the incorrect reply, and what smooth wash quite means

A chronic washer lifts paint, cleans concrete, and strips deck stain. It needs to no longer touch asphalt shingles. Even at moderate settings, the circulation dislodges granules and might force water below lap traces. You will get a “easy” seem that hides the smash until eventually a better freeze-thaw cycle. I have seen roofs that regarded proper the day after a hard wash, then misplaced 5 to 8 years of service lifestyles for the reason that the protective layer used to be blasted away.

Soft Wash Roof Cleaning makes use of low power mixed with a cleansing resolution that ambitions organic and natural boom. The pressure is kind of what you get from a garden hose with a sprayer, around 60 to a hundred psi at the surface. The chemistry does the paintings. For algae on asphalt, a sodium hypochlorite combine, tempered with surfactants and a bit of thickener, contacts the improvement and breaks it down. The mix power issues. Too scorching, and also you bleach pigments and chance run-off wreck to landscaping. Too susceptible, and you desire repeated packages that soak the roof unnecessarily. Experienced techs in Maryville understand how to track concentration for spring, summer season, and fall temperatures, given that solution live times amendment with warm and colour.

Good crews pre-moist crops, keep an eye on run-off, and work from the properly right down to keep streaking. They rinse to impartial, then flush gutters. How ordinarily must always Maryville roofs be washed?

There is not any one-dimension resolution. For a standard asphalt roof with partial coloration, a delicate wash each two to 4 years helps to keep algae from commencing. If your home is ringed with hardwoods otherwise you face a wooded ridge, each two years is realistic. If your roof sees full sunlight and the attic is good ventilated, four years may well be enough.

Timing things extra than the calendar. The most sensible time for Roof Cleaning in our section is spring or early fall. Spring removes pollen and healthy movie formerly summer time warmth bakes it in. Fall clears the floor before winter’s slash solar angle stretches drying occasions and continues shaded regions damp. Mid-summer washes can work, but you desire an early begin and diminish warmness to present the solution controlled dwell with no flash-drying.

Metal roofs tolerate longer periods, most of the time 4 to six years, until you will have a problematic status seam profile with tight valleys and tree muddle. Cedar wishes careful, much less widely wide-spread washing with gentler chemistry and extra rinsing. If person costs the related mixture and agenda for cedar as for asphalt, that may be a pink flag.

DIY spotting and prevention that essentially helps

You do now not desire to get at the roof to catch concerns early. A first rate set of binoculars helps you to experiment ridge to eave after a rain, that's while early streaks coach up optimum. Take a number of footage twice a year from the related spot. Compare shading, now not simply deep coloration. Look to the left and proper of skylights, alongside the outer thirds of long runs, and under the shadows forged through chimneys around nine a.m.

Trim again branches that throw steady colour at the roof, pretty at the north and east aspects. Create a 6 to ten foot clearance wherein you can. Clean gutters every fall and spring so water sheds promptly. Algae flourishes where water lingers on the shingle side. Check attic ventilation too. If you can actually easily dangle your hand near the attic peak on a summer time afternoon devoid of feeling stifled warmness, your ridge and soffit are probable doing their process. If now not, extra airflow will aid the roof dry swifter after dew.

Some home owners deploy zinc or copper strips near the ridge as a passive algae deterrent. Rainwater picks up hint metals that wash down the roof and inhibit development. They guide, chiefly on uncomplicated gable roofs, however they're no longer a magic restore. On elaborate roofs with hips and valleys, the steel’s protective “shadow” does now not attain each and every airplane. Consider strips as an add-on, now not a substitute for Roof Washing.

When cleansing isn't very enough

Sometimes streaking exposes a deeper obstacle. If cleansing shows known granule loss, curled shingle edges, or blistered tabs, the roof is telling you that's getting older out. In Maryville’s local weather, a neatly-made architectural shingle can final 20 to 25 years with care. If your roof is impending that vary and appears tired after cleaning, this is truthful to start out planning for alternative. Cleaning still helps you get a little bit greater existence, and it makes the roof protected to walk for a expert inspection.

Flashing mess ups, highly around chimneys and sidewalls, can even masquerade as algae lines. A brown stain lower than a chimney that returns promptly after cleansing may well be soot and runoff interacting with a small leak route, now not algae. If a stain reappears within a month on a wiped clean roof, have a roof repairer appearance carefully at the flashing and counterflashing.
